Plz, help me!!! Write each interval as an inequality. Then graph the solutions. (–∞,5)

The interval notation given to us means that x is between negative infinity and 5, excluding both endpoints.

So we can write -\infty < x < 5 which shortens to x < 5

The graph will have an open hole at 5 on the number line, and shading to the left to indicate all points smaller than 5.

Find the explicit formula for a 1 =-4,a n =a n-1 +9,n&gt;=2
Mrrafil [7]

Given:

a_1=-4 and a_n=a_{n-1}+9 where n\geq 2.

To find:

The explicit formula for the given recursive formula.

Solution:

We know that recursive formula of an AP is:

a_n=a_{n-1}+d

Where, d is the common difference.

We have,

a_n=a_{n-1}+9

Here, d=9.

The first term of the AP is a_1=-4.

The explicit formula for an AP is:

a_n=a_1+(n-1)d

Substituting a_1=-4 and d=9, we get

a_n=-4+(n-1)9

a_n=-4+9n-9

a_n=-13+9n

Therefore, the required explicit formula for the given sequence is a_n=-13+9n.

What is the exact distance from (–1, 4) to (6, –2)? (4 points) units units units units
irina1246 [14]

Answer:

\sqrt{85}

Step-by-step explanation:

Calculate the distance d using the distance formula

d = √ (x₂ - x₁ )² + (y₂ - y₁ )²

with (x₁, y₁ ) = (- 1, 4) and (x₂, y₂ ) = (6, - 2)

d = \sqrt{(6+1)^2+(-2-4)^2}

  = \sqrt{7^2+(-6)^2}

  = \sqrt{49+36}

  = \sqrt{85} ← exact distance

Solve x2 = 12x - 15 by completing the square. Which is the solution set of the equation?
Novosadov [1.4K]

Answer:

(6-√21,  6+√21)

Step-by-step explanation:

x^2 - 12x = -15

(x - 6)^2 - 36 = -15

(x - 6)^2 = 21

x - 6 = ± √21

x = 6  ± √21

A person earns 23,000 one year and gets a 5% raise in salary. Calculate the new yearly salary using a percent greater than 100
Kazeer [188]

Answer:

24,150

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that :

Salary earned this year = 23,000

Percentage Raise in salary for the new year = 5%

The new yearly salary can be obtained thus ;

(100% + percentage raise in salary) * salary earned this year

(100% + 5%) * 23,000

105% * 23000

1.05 * 23000

24,150
